Visual estimates of seal abundance from aerial surveys conducted by a Cessna-185 in the San Juan Islands, Salish Sea in 2008 (Seal_response_to_prey project)

<p>Number of seals counted during several aerial surveys of the Salish Sea during July and August of 2008. Data are also available from <a href=\"http://osprey.bco-dmo.org/dataset.cfm?id=14099&amp;flag=view\">2007 surveys</a>.</p> <p><b>Related publications:</b> (Both available from <a href=\"http://biol.wwu.edu/mbel/?page=papers\" target=\"_blank\">Alejandro Acevedo's lab website</a>.)<br /> <b>Howard</b>, S. 2009. Seasonal energy budgets to model energy use and prey consumption in harbor seals (<i>Phoca vitulina</i>) in the San Juan Islands, WA. MSc thesis, Department of Biology, Western Washington University, Bellingham, WA.<br /> <b>Hardee</b>, S. 2008. Movements and home ranges of harbor seals (<i>Phoca vitulina</i>) in the Georgia Basin: implications for marine reservinland waters of the Pacific Northwest. MSc thesis, Department of Biology, Western Washington University, Bellingham, WA.</p>
